Therefore we offer in additon to our À la Carte menu a Theater menu which is available during regular Centaur season from 5:30pm to 6:30pm and our Table d'Hôte. Gourmets in hurry can always count on us. If you desire to savour the chef's specialties, our Dégustation menu will seduce you.

Atmosphere... The resto is inside hotel Bonaparte. The set up is nice with proper table cloth, wine glasses, cloth napkin but average quality cutlery. The wine glasses could be of better quality especially when the wine list is quite good though not exhaustive. This resto is suitable for business discussion or client entertainment. Service... Our waitress is knowledgeable & attentive. Unfortunately, the resto does not have a sommelier (given its wine list) so our waitress tried her best to double up but it shows her lack of knowledge & experience in that field. Food... In general good, unfortunately for me, my lamb shank was dry & kind of burnt, making it a kind of leathery skin on the outside. They did offer to change it & so I ordered a filet mignon as it was quick to cook since my family members are almost finished with their main course. All in, this resto would merit a 3.5 stars over 5
